12. WHAT DOES THIS MEAN IN PRACTICE
USE WORKFLOW MAPPING
1.Identify a care segment that has opportunities for
improvement
2.Develop a first draft of the improvement by interviewing those
that do the work (‘experts’)
3.Start with post-it notes - then electronic
4.Validate the draft against the actual process (observation)
5.Close the loop: repeat the exercise with your experts
